Output 2603046a3b98bc011376af5b5efc98d56c9ce25cc4455eec3edb4a145dd43788:0

value
1355508
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9b0a3badfbc56fff7db40647f59f1f775a1d2db8 OP_EQUAL
address
3FpnvHcvLGKteY5RkRMGnF3a9oxiGZdMfy
transaction
2603046a3b98bc011376af5b5efc98d56c9ce25cc4455eec3edb4a145dd43788
confirmations
352513
spent
true